Definition of geotag verb from the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ary

geotag

verb

  1. geotag something to add an electronic tag (= a symbol, set of letters, etc.) to a photograph, video or other information on the internet to show the exact place that it comes from
    • The site displays travel news, London traffic cams, local weather, geotagged photos and speed cameras.
